TOP-QUARK MASS IN A DYNAMIC SYMMETRY-BREAKING SCHEME WITH RADIATIVE B-QUARK AND TAU-LEPTON MASSES

摘要
We propose an extension of the dynamical electroweak-symmetry-breaking scheme via top-quark condensate where b-quark and tau-lepton masses arise at low energies as one-loop radiative corrections out of the top quark. Corresponding to the compositeness scale LAMBDA = 10(15) - 10(6) GeV, the top-quark mass is predicted to be m(t) = 159-200 GeV, in good agreement with the electroweak rho parameter.
